What Is Quick Sync And Why Is It Important For Your CPU?
Quick Sync is a hardware-based video encoding and decoding technology developed by Intel. It is integrated into Intel CPUs and allows for faster and more efficient video transcoding and streaming. This feature is particularly important for those who use their computers for activities such as video editing, streaming, or gaming.
Quick Sync utilizes a dedicated media processing unit within the CPU that offloads the video encoding and decoding tasks from the CPU cores, resulting in significantly improved performance and reduced power consumption. This means that tasks like video rendering or streaming can be completed much faster and with a lower impact on overall system performance.
The importance of Quick Sync lies in its ability to enhance the user’s multimedia experience by enabling smooth, high-quality video encoding and decoding. It provides the means for users to enjoy higher resolution videos, reduced buffering during streaming, and improved video editing and rendering capabilities.
Furthermore, the integration of Quick Sync technology into CPUs eliminates the need for additional hardware or software solutions, making it a cost-effective and convenient option for users who require efficient and high-performance video processing capabilities.
Checking For Quick Sync Compatibility On Intel Processors.
Quick Sync is an advanced hardware acceleration technology developed by Intel that enhances the video encoding and decoding processes on CPUs. If you have an Intel processor, you may want to determine if it includes Quick Sync and take advantage of its capabilities.
To check for Quick Sync compatibility on Intel processors, you can follow a simple process. Firstly, you need to identify the specific model of your Intel CPU. You can do this by accessing the task manager, right-clicking on the Windows taskbar, selecting “Task Manager,” and then clicking on the “Performance” tab. Here, you will find your CPU model listed under the “CPU” section.
Once you have identified your processor model, you can visit Intel’s official website to find detailed specifications for your CPU. Look for the processor’s information and check if it includes Quick Sync technology. Alternatively, you can also use a system information tool such as CPU-Z or HWiNFO to get detailed information about your CPU, including Quick Sync support.
By following these steps, you can easily determine if your Intel processor comes with Quick Sync technology, allowing you to explore its benefits and leverage its video processing capabilities.

Understanding The Benefits And Limitations Of Quick Sync Technology
Quick Sync technology is an important feature for CPUs as it accelerates video encoding and decoding processes, allowing for smooth video playback and fast file transcoding. Understanding the benefits and limitations of Quick Sync is crucial for users who want to make the most out of their CPU’s capabilities.
One of the key advantages of Quick Sync is its superior performance when compared to software-based video processing solutions. It leverages the built-in GPU (Graphics Processing Unit) capabilities of modern Intel processors, offloading the video processing tasks from the CPU to the GPU. This results in faster and more efficient video encoding and decoding, enabling users to enjoy high-quality multimedia content without any interruptions.
Quick Sync also offers low latency, which is particularly beneficial for real-time applications like video conferencing and game streaming. It reduces the time between capturing and transmitting the video, making these tasks smoother and more responsive.
However, Quick Sync does have some limitations. It supports a limited range of codecs and formats, which means that it may not be compatible with all video files. Additionally, Quick Sync may not deliver the same level of video quality as software-based encoding methods, especially for more demanding video processing tasks.
Overall, Quick Sync technology provides significant advantages in terms of performance and latency for video encoding and decoding tasks. However, users need to be aware of its limitations and choose the appropriate applications and file formats to make the most of this technology.
Troubleshooting Steps If Quick Sync Is Not Working On Your CPU
If you are facing issues with Quick Sync not functioning properly on your CPU, there are several troubleshooting steps you can follow to resolve the problem. Firstly, ensure that your CPU supports Quick Sync technology. Check the manufacturer’s website or product documentation for confirmation.
Next, make sure you have installed the latest graphics drivers for your CPU. Outdated or incompatible drivers can cause conflicts and prevent Quick Sync from working correctly. Visit the manufacturer’s website to download and install the appropriate drivers.
If Quick Sync is still not functioning, check your system’s BIOS settings. Ensure that integrated graphics are enabled, as Quick Sync relies on the integrated GPU. You may need to consult your motherboard’s manual for instructions on accessing and modifying BIOS settings.
Additionally, check that your software applications are compatible with Quick Sync. Some applications may require specific settings or updates to utilize the technology effectively. Consult the software’s documentation or support resources for guidance.
In some cases, conflicts with other hardware or software components can affect Quick Sync’s functionality. Temporarily disable or uninstall any conflicting software or hardware devices and test Quick Sync again.
If problems persist, it may be beneficial to contact the CPU manufacturer or seek assistance from technical support forums or communities. They can provide further troubleshooting steps tailored to your specific CPU model and configuration.

2. Are all Intel CPUs equipped with Quick Sync?
No, not all Intel CPUs have Quick Sync. Quick Sync is typically found in Intel CPUs that have an integrated graphics processor (iGPU). So, CPUs without an iGPU, or with older generations of iGPUs, may not have Quick Sync.
3. Can I enable Quick Sync if my CPU supports it but it’s not active?
Yes, it is possible to enable Quick Sync if your CPU supports it but it’s not active by default. To do this, you need to enter your computer’s BIOS or UEFI settings and look for an option related to the iGPU. Enable the iGPU and save the settings. After restarting your computer, Quick Sync should be active.
